7 Ways Online Learning Can Launch or Advance Your Career

You might already have a goal in mind. Maybe you’re thinking about starting fresh in a field that’s more meaningful to you. Perhaps you’re building on your experience to increase your earning potential. But when your days are filled with work, family, and everything else that needs your attention, career goals often end up on hold. 

That’s where online learning makes a difference. It gives you the flexibility to study in a way that fits your routine and supports your long-term growth. You can study from home, fit coursework around your schedule, and develop the skills needed to advance in your career. Whether it’s after the kids are asleep, during your lunch break, or before the day begins, online learning makes it possible to keep moving toward your goals. 

Here’s how an online diploma program can help you build the career you want.

Get the Flexibility You Need to Learn on Your Schedule

An online learning student in virtual class.

For many people, the biggest challenge is simply finding the time and space to study consistently. Traditional classroom learning often means fixed schedules, distant locations, commuting, and time away from family. This can make learning hard to manage. Online learning removes those barriers, making career-focused training accessible to anyone willing to learn. This flexibility allows you to pursue career-changing education that fits around your personal or professional commitments, no matter what stage of life you’re in. Access Modern Tools and Resources used in Today’s Workplaces

Online learning works best when it’s supported by the right tools. The best online diploma programs give you access to resources that make learning both engaging and practical. Courses are hosted on intuitive platforms that organize your lessons, discussions, assignments, and grades in one place. 

You don’t need to be tech-savvy to succeed. Many adults returning to school haven’t used digital systems in a while, so the best programs are designed with that in mind. 

“Students learn through interactive videos, case studies, and activities like Kahoots that make lessons engaging and easy to follow. They also develop computer skills through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int, and Outlook, gaining practical experience with tools used in most workplaces.” 
— Taylor L., Vice President of Academics at SBC College  

These digital learning resources make learning easier to follow and help you stay motivated as you prepare for your new career.

Learn at Your Own Pace with Personalized, Self-Paced Learning

An effective online diploma program follows a modular learning approach that allows you to focus on one subject at a time. This personalized education format helps you give each topic your full attention, build understanding gradually, and complete each course before moving on to the next.  

To keep your learning organized and consistent, each course includes scheduled lessons, discussions, and assignment deadlines. Instructors are actively involved, providing feedback, answering questions, and keeping you connected throughout the course. You can watch videos, revisit recorded lessons, and access digital materials at the times that work best for you. 

This structure helps you make steady progress, retain what you learn, and balance your studies with other life responsibilities.

Study a Practical, Career-Focused Curriculum Designed for Real Jobs

The best online diploma programs are designed with input from industry professionals to meet workplace needs. They prepare you for careers in in-demand fields such as healthcare, business, administration, legal, and computer and design technology, where skilled professionals are always needed. 

Learning is based on workplace scenarios such as following office procedures, preparing documents, using industry software, and communicating professionally.  

By choosing an online diploma program that emphasizes practical learning, you’ll graduate ready to contribute in your new career.

Build Real-World Skills & Tech Proficiency

The right online diploma program connects classroom learning with the technology used in most workplaces. By working with specialized software, managing projects, and collaborating through virtual platforms, you develop job-ready skills that prepare you to succeed in a variety of professional settings.

Graduate Job-Ready With Skills Employers Value

The transition from student to professional becomes easier when your education includes practical experience. Online diploma programs that offer hands-on training and practicum placements allow you to apply what you’ve learned in workplace settings and start building connections that support your career growth. 

Employers recognize the value of this training and often see a noticeable difference in graduates from career-focused diploma programs.

FAQs

What equipment or software do I need for online learning?
You’ll need a reliable computer, a stable internet connection, and access to the digital platforms used for your courses. At SBC College, you’ll be guided through user-friendly platforms for coursework, group discussions and assignments, with tech support available when needed. 

Can I set my own pace and schedule for online learning?
Yes. You can access materials 24/7, watch recorded lessons, and study when it fits your schedule. The modular format lets you focus on one course at a time, making learning more manageable. 

What key skills does online learning build?
Online learning builds organization, communication, and technical skills. In the right online diploma program, you’ll also gain experience using industry software and tools commonly used in today’s workplaces. 

How do I stay motivated to complete courses with online learning?
Look for a program with the modular structure and student support to help you stay on track. Instructors, advisors, and student services will check in throughout your program, and interactive lessons will make learning engaging. 

Will I interact with instructors and classmates during online learning?
Yes. In the right program, through live sessions, group discussions, and peer projects, you’ll connect with classmates who share your goals and learn from industry-experienced instructors who bring workplace insights into each lesson to keep learning engaging and practical.
